New logo of BSNL unveiled

Union Minister for Communication Jyotiraditya Scindia has said that since the beginning of the rollout of 4G, the subscribers of Bharat Sanchar Nigam Limited (BSNL) have increased from 75 lakh to 1.8 crore in the last six months. India is likely to see real GDP growth at 7.2 % for Financial Year 2024-25: RBI
